Output f57030527db07cdd141fc0afd0a5bf9da1d1322d4776da4be862a9df442a7c1a:23

value
158090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c633376ef68189b88c410f9c5863c60622c9609 OP_EQUAL
address
3MnKRMYnbwZ4po78bdUvJ56NECszXqN2US
transaction
f57030527db07cdd141fc0afd0a5bf9da1d1322d4776da4be862a9df442a7c1a
confirmations
321115
spent
true